UNPKG

@wix/design-system

Version:

@wix/design-system

15 lines 758 B
import React from 'react'; import InputConsumer from '../InputConsumer'; import { st, classes } from './IconAffix.st.css.js'; const IconAffix = ({ children, dataHook, }) => (React.createElement(InputConsumer, { consumerCompName: IconAffix.displayName }, ({ size, inPrefix, inSuffix, border, disabled, onInputClicked }) => (React.createElement("div", { className: st(classes.root, { size, inPrefix, inSuffix, border, disabled, }), onClick: !disabled ? onInputClicked : undefined, "data-hook": dataHook }, React.cloneElement(children, { size: size === 'tiny' || size === 'small' ? '18px' : '24px', }))))); IconAffix.displayName = 'Input.IconAffix'; export default IconAffix; //# sourceMappingURL=IconAffix.js.map